Sinsinnati Beer Cheese Dip
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 0 Minutes
Cook Time: 5 Minutes
Ready In: 5 Minutes
Servings: 4
O.K.,it's really Cincinnati Beer Cheese Dip,but it's so good I had to change the name!!!
Ingredients:
3 sharp cheeses, 6 ounces of each; try asiago, cheddar, cooper, parmesan, pecorino romano or manchego
1-1/2 ounces roquefort cheese
2 tablespoons butter
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 medium onion, finely diced
1 teaspoon worcestershire sauce
hot sauce to taste
1 cup dark beer
Directions:
1. In a mixing bowl, with an electric mixer, mix together all the cheese, butter, garlic, onion, Worcestershire sauce and hot sauce.
2. In a small saucepan, warm the beer but not to a boil.
3. Gradually add the warm beer to the cheese mixture and mix until of good dipping consistency.
4. Cover and refrigerate 1 hour before serving.
5. Really cheesey and flavorful spread for crackers!
